It really depends on your home and your roof but adding panels to an unshaded west facing roof can be a great move.
Panels mounted on a standard pitch roof facing east or west will produce approximately 15 less output than panels mounted on a south facing roof of a standard pitch.
However solar panels can be orientated on any roof that faces south of either east or west.

Therefore directions like southwest or southeast are fine.
That s much better than most people would guess and even an east west facing roof can generate around 80 of the maximum.
Of course you cannot install east west facing solar panels on your roof if it does not already slant in those directions.
At lower pitches say 30 the east west facing panels perform slightly closer to south.
